Season 2, Ep.8 - The Balance of Grace and Accountability
Use Left/Right to seek, Home/End to jump to start or end. Hold shift to jump forward or backward.
In this episode of the Make A Man podcast, Brett and RJ discuss the complexities of navigating conflict and accountability as men. They explore the balance between grace and accountability, emphasizing the importance of calling out sin in a loving manner. The conversation delves into the concept of tough love, the need for discernment in how to approach others, and the significance of humility and change in relationships. Drawing on biblical examples, they highlight Jesus' model for addressing sin and the necessity of being direct yet compassionate in communication.
